Mitchell Company sells its product for $100 per unit. The company's accountant provided the following cost information:Manufactu

ring costs $25,000 + 45% of salesSelling costs $15,000 + 20% of salesAdministrative costs $25,000 + 10% of sales What is the company's break-even point in units?
Business
1 answer:
LenaWriter [7]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Break-even point= 2600 units

Explanation:

<u>The break-even point refers to the units necessary to cover a company's total amount of fixed and variable expenses during a specified period of time. </u>

The formula to calculate the break-even point is the following:

break-even point= fixed costs/contribution margin

Contribution Margin: The contribution margin is a product's price minus all associated variable costs (sales- variable costs), resulting in the incremental profit earned for each unit sold.

Fixed costs: A fixed cost is a cost that does not change with an increase or decrease in the amount of goods or services produced or sold.

In this case:

Contribution margin= $100 - (45+20+10)= $25

Fixed Costs= 25000+15000+25000= $65000

<u>Break-even point= 65000/25= 2600 units</u>

3. Which part of a letter identifies the address of the person writing the letter
bulgar [2K]

Answer:

Return Address

Explanation:

There are primarily <u>7 parts of a letter</u> and these are the following:

<em>1. Letterhead/Heading (business) or Return Address (an individual)</em>

<em>2. Date</em>

<em>3. Inside Address</em>

<em>4. Salutation/Greeting</em>

<em>5. Body</em>

<em>6. Complimentary Close</em>

<em>7. Signature</em>

The "Return Address" refers to the <em>address of the sender.</em> This includes the name of the sender as well. This is very important especially if the letter requires a response from the recipient.
